About W. E. Schmitendorf
W. E. Schmitendorf is a scholar working on Control and Systems Engineering, Aerospace Engineering, Computational Theory and Mathematics, Numerical Analysis and Civil and Structural Engineering, having authored 100 papers that have together received 1.8k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Stability and Control of Uncertain Systems (51 papers), Advanced Control Systems Optimization (27 papers), Guidance and Control Systems (20 papers), Adaptive Control of Nonlinear Systems (19 papers), Optimization and Variational Analysis (17 papers), Control Systems and Identification (12 papers), Stability and Controllability of Differential Equations (11 papers) and Vibration Control and Rheological Fluids (11 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Control and Systems Engineering (1.2k citations), Numerical Analysis (152 citations), Computational Theory and Mathematics (309 citations), Civil and Structural Engineering (350 citations) and Aerospace Engineering (241 citations). W. E. Schmitendorf has collaborated with scholars based in United States, South Korea and Germany. Frequent co-authors include Faryar Jabbari, B. Ross Barmish, J. N. Yang, G. Leitmann, İ. Emre Köse, Jinghong Wu, C.V. Hollot, Stephen Citron, William J. Palm and James Alfred Walker. Their work appears in journals such as IEEE Transactions on Automatic Control, Journal of Optimization Theory and Applications, Journal of Dynamic Systems Measurement and Control, Journal of Guidance Control and Dynamics and Automatica.
